Mobil Producing Nigeria Unlimited on Friday announced the appointment of Mr Paul McGrath as the new Chairman and Managing Director of the organisation, with effect from  March 1.

Ogechukwu Udeagha, Manager, Media and Communication, said in a statement issued in Lagos that McGrath will succeed Mr Nolan O’Neal, who elected to retire after 34 years of service.

Udeagha said that McGrath was a senior executive in charge of project execution for ExxonMobil Development Company, based in Houston, Texas.

McGrath joined ExxonMobil in 1999 and had held a variety of technical and managerial positions in upstream and downstream operations while working in the U.K, Korea, Qatar, Australia and the U.S.
